SMART FACTORIES & AUTOMATION


EMBRACING THE TECHNOLOGY


The automation technologies available to organisations today are compelling. From autonomous mobile robots to automated guidance vehicles, as Industry 4.0 gains both momentum and maturity, confidence in the quality of the technology to deliver and enable significant operational change continues to grow. But, if businesses fail to get processes aligned and truly understand the goal of any automation investment, problems will arise. By considering both the processes and the people who operate those processes today, organisations can take a far more intelligent approach to automation. Add in simulation to understand how AMRs, for example, might operate at different times is critical to highlighting potential problems and avoiding inefficiencies.


Plus, of course, these systems deliver real time data in huge detail. Combining analytics to monitor conditions in real time with dynamic fleet scheduling and route optimisation will enable continuous improvement. The technology is brilliant; but it is the way it is deployed, the way orders are batched, and schedules planned, the way people are managed and skilled, that is the key to truly realising the potential of automation.
